歡迎來到Linux教程網
Linux教程網
Linux教程網
Linux教程網
您现在的位置: Linux教程網 >> UnixLinux >  >> Linux基礎 >> Linux教程

在Ubuntu 10.10下安裝JDK配置Eclipse配置j2me

環境:Ubuntu10.10
下載工具:jdk,版本為jdk-6u23-linux-i586.bin。(百度:oracal java)
eclipse,版本eclipse-java-helios-SR2-linux-gtk.tar.gz
1。jdk手動安裝
新立得無法安裝,sudo apt-get sun-java6-jdk 也不行,只能手動了
下載好jdk
Terminal
cd進入下載好的jdk文件夾,再執行cp命令,把文件復制到/usr/local/lib
之後再執行
sudo chmod +x jdk-6u24-linux-i586.bin
sudo ./jdk-6u24-linux-i586.bin
 執行最後一步命令後便在當前目錄下多了一個“jdk1.6.0_04“的目錄,裡面是jdk-6u4-linux-i586.bin解壓後JDK的全部文件;
配置環境變量
$sudo gedit /etc/environment
在文本編輯器裡寫入下面兩行內容:
PATH=“/usr/local/lib/jdk1.6.0_24/bin"(已存在的話用毛好分隔)
CLASSPATH="/usr/local/lib/jdk1.6.0_24/lib" 
JAVA_HOME="/usr/local/lib/jdk1.6.0_24"
由於ubuntu中可能會有默認的jdk,如openjdk,所以,為了使默認使用的是我們安裝的jdk,還要進行如下工作。
執行
$ sudo update-alternatives --install /usr/bin/java java /usr/local/lib/jdk1.6.0_24/bin/java 300
$ sudo update-alternatives --install /usr/bin/javac javac /usr/local/lib/jdk1.6.0_24/bin/javac 300
通過這一步將我們安裝的jdk加入java選單。
然後執行
代碼:
update-alternatives --config java
通過這一步選擇系統默認的jdk
注銷,Terminal,運行java -version。顯示:
java version "1.6.0_24"
Java(TM) SE Runtime Environment (build 1.6.0_24-b07)
Java HotSpot(TM) Client VM (build 19.1-b02, mixed mode, sharing)
配置成功。

安裝eclipse
下載好,解壓,將文件復制至java目錄
sudo mv /home/empty/下載/eclipse /usr/local/lib/
雙擊eclipse,下一步。。。。ok
或者
Terminal
sudo apt-get eclipse-palmform


配置j2me
1. 下載SUN WTK(無線工具包)
http://java.sun.com/products/sjwtoolkit/download.html
2. 安裝SUN WTK
# ./sun_java_wireless_toolkit-2_5_2-linux.bin
終端命令:
1).進入bin所在目錄
2).執行命令:sudo chmod +x /usr/local/sun_java_wireless_toolkit-2_5_2-ml-linux.bin
(給當前用戶增加對.bin文件運行的權限)

3).執行命令:sudo ./sun_java_wireless_toolkit-2_5_2-ml-linux.bin (進行安裝)
sudo rm sun_java_wireless_toolkit-2_5_2-ml-linux.bin (刪除安裝文件)

把eclipseme.feature_1.6.8_site.zip拷貝到Eclipse根目錄下
然後開始安裝“J2ME插件壓縮包”:Help->SoftwareUpdate->Find and Install->Search for new features to install->New Archived site…->選擇“eclipseme.feature_1.6.8_site.zip”,然後點擊“Open”->OK ->finish ->next-> Accept… -> next ->All Install… -> yes重啟Eclipse。


四.在Eclipse中配置WTK

      啟動Eclipse, Window -> Preferences ,進入配置窗口。
      選擇 J2ME菜單,在 WTK Root 裡填入WTK的安裝目錄
      J2ME->Device Management->Import, 目錄項填入 /home/user/homework/WTK2.2/bin , 刷新按鈕 Refresh ,
      確定 Finsh, 然後選擇自己比較喜歡的一款手機皮膚。
      J2ME->Packaging->Obfuscation, 填入WTK的安裝目錄 /home/user/homework/WTK2.2 。 搞定!

測試程序:
new project -> j2me -> sre new class "Hello"
  1. import javax.microedition.lcdui.Display; 
  2. import javax.microedition.lcdui.Form; 
  3. import javax.microedition.midlet.MIDlet; 
  4. import javax.microedition.midlet.MIDletStateChangeException; 
  5. public class Hello extends MIDlet { 
  6.    Display display; 
  7.    public Hello() { 
  8.        super(); 
  9.        display = Display.getDisplay(this); 
  10.    } 
  11.    protected void destroyApp(boolean arg0) throws MIDletStateChangeException { 
  12.    } 
  13.    protected void pauseApp() { 
  14.    } 
  15.    protected void startApp() throws MIDletStateChangeException { 
  16.        Form form = new Form("Another Hello World"); 
  17.        form.append("Hello World!"); 
  18.        display.setCurrent(form); 
  19.    } 
  20. } 

運行成功~

Copyright © Linux教程網 All Rights Reserved